Here's another Coachella 2022 lineup addition to get excited about, Scenestar readers! Goldenvoice has added the all-female k-pop foursome, Aespa, to their festival lineup! Aespa will be making their Coachella debut on the Coachella Main Stage on Saturday, April 23, in the evening and will be streamed online via YouTube. SM Entertainment has confirmed that Aespa will be performing their hits "Black Mamba", "Next Level", and "Savage" in their festival set.
This is the third all-female k-pop act to perform at Coachella following 2NE1's reunion during the 88Rising time slot on the Coachella Main Stage Weekend 1 of this year and Blackpink's set on the Sahara stage in 2019.
As we previously announced, the second weekend of Coachella 2022 will be taking place from Friday, April 22, to Sunday, April 24, at the Empire Polo Club in Indio, Calif. Headlining Coachella this year are Billie Eilish, Harry Styles, Swedish House Mafia, and The Weeknd (Replacing Ye (Kanye West).
